Fan ovens
If you are looking for a multi-functional oven that can handle all you need, think about a fan oven. These models use an air blower to circulate hot, which allows them to cook more evenly. They also can reduce cooking time. These models are ideal for roasting, baking and grilling.
They are also an excellent choice for those who dislike the smell of conventional cooking ovens. They're less odour-producing, making them better for those with sensitive noses or suffer from asthma.
Another advantage of fan ovens is that they're usually smaller than other kinds of oven, which makes them perfect for those with limited space. They can be placed at eye level or under the hob, making them an excellent choice for small families or those who are budget-conscious.
However, if you want something more expensive, you can find models with extra features. For example, some have digital controls that are easier to read and can offer more flexibility than dials. Some models are equipped with additional shelves, which are helpful for best oven Uk baking large casseroles and cakes.
These models also come with other useful functions, like auto-programs that automatically adjust temperatures and cooking time for various food items. Some models include steam functions that use water to create hot, steamy steam. This allows food like croissants and bread to develop a golden crust while remaining light and fluffy on the inside.
Other things to look for are telescopic runners that sit on the shelves which make it simpler to slide them in and out of the shelves. Certain models come with separate grills that are perfect to cook meat. Some models have catalytic lines that are designed to get rid of grime and grease from the inside of your oven, so you don't have to clean it as frequently.
Keep in mind that the cost of an oven can vary greatly depending on the dimensions and Best Ovens features of an oven. So, if you're looking for a budget-friendly model, you should check the specification and choose one that meets your needs. Also, be aware of whether you require all the extra features. If not, you can save money by selecting an affordable model that has the essential features.

Multi-function ovens
A multi-function appliance blends different cooking styles into one device. They use a mix of bottom and top heat, grilling, and fans to cook food to perfection. They are also great for defrosting or reheating food. Compared to conventional ovens, they can reduce your energy bills by up to 40%.
Multi-function ovens come in different models and price ranges, depending on the features and model. Certain models are advertised as smart, meaning they can be controlled remotely from your smartphone. This can be especially helpful if you're on the go and want to ensure your dinner is ready when you return after work.
The most basic of these ovens can cost under PS150 and more sophisticated models can cost more than that price. The type of oven you choose will depend on your requirements and also take into account how often you'll use it. A double oven is more suitable for those who plan to use the oven regularly. It is also important to consider the dimensions of your kitchen as well as the space you have to accommodate the oven.
